Under supervision, this position provides Respite Services for children or adolescents experiencing Serious Emotional/Neurobiological/Behavioral Disorders. The focus is on improving quality of life and supporting independent functioning while strengthening, supporting, and preserving families. Services are individualized and delivered collaboratively in an out-patient setting to promote safety, well-being, and overall progress while providing caregivers with time-limited temporary relief from the ongoing responsibility of care.

ABOUT PMS
Founded in 1969, PMS is a non-profit organization with over 1,300 employees providing services at 100+ locations in New Mexico. Our diverse services include primary care, dental, behavioral health, early childhood education, supportive living, and senior programs. We concentrate our resources on meeting the needs of underserved areas of New Mexico. We operate the largest network of federally qualified health centers in the state.
